“…Qualitative comparative analysis draws on Boolean algebra to determine which configurations of causal conditions are related to an observed outcome (Ragin, 2000). The method is increasingly used in the business and management literature (e.g., Bell, Filatotchev, & Aguilera, 2013;Crilly, 2011;Fiss, 2011;Judge et al, 2015;Schneider et al, 2010).…”
